From: Town of Scituate

The Town of Scituate has implemented a Tier 4 water ban.  This is a total ban on all nonessential outside water use due to the current drought conditions and the strains being placed on our wells.  This includes lawn irrigation, watering of flowers, filling of pools, vehicle washing as well as boats.  The Water department is fining violators with fines as high as $300 a day.  Additional information can be found on the Scituate Water Division website here 

We all need to do our best to conserve water during these drought conditions.  As the drought worsens, the water tables supplying our wells continue to drop, lowering the output from those wells, making us more dependent on the water treatment plant. We encounter more manganese in the system because our aging Surface Water Treatment Plant (SWTP) wasn’t designed to treat manganese.
